Purpose of Job

The Africa CDC seeks to recruit a national and citizen of any Member State of the African Union to be a roster member of the African Volunteers Health Corps. This is not recruitment for employment but volunteer service for Africa CDC. The potential AVoHC Volunteers candidates are those who have experience in Public Health Management, social and behavioural science, epidemiology, communication, Infection Prevention and Control, laboratory, mental health, etc., from Africa Union Member States. The potential applicants are encouraged to be fully employed and willing to volunteer for the skills and competencies any time requested by Africa CDC.

Main Functions

In the context of the Africa CDC Public Health Emergency Incident Management System (IMS), at the different levels, the Risk Communication and Community Engagement expert will provide technical support to the subnational/national/regional/continental incident management teams, the Ministry of Health (MOH), and other relevant government authorities working with communities to strengthen the national system for risk communication and community engagement in response to public health emergencies in order to ensure that both the population and service providers adhere to all relevant prevention measures.

Key Deliverables

During the deployment, the Risk Communication and Community Engagement expert shall perform the following major duties and responsibilities:

  • Strengthening national risk communication and outreach policies and regulations and preparedness and response capacities
  • Strengthening risk communication capacity of the health professionals and other relevant stakeholders before, during, and after public health emergencies
  • Support the general population and vulnerable groups to adopt protective measures through building trust and engaging with communities and affected populations;
  • Promote emergency risk communication practice – from planning, messaging, channels and methods of communication and engagement, to monitoring and evaluation – based on a systematic assessment of the evidence on what worked and what did not work during recent emergencies.
  • Support the production and dissemination of tailored public health messages about public health emergency through appropriate national/sub-national channels.
